Explain about the short term and long term interest rate in money demand.
The Opportunity Cost of Holding Money Demand:
a. Short-term interest rates
Rates onto assets which come due in less than six-months.
These rates tend to shift together due to basic supply and demand. What is the reason? Investors will shift their money out of any short-term financial asset which offers a lower than average interest rate.
b. Long-term interest rates
Rates onto assets which come due into more than six-months.
